Description: What do your department's monthly financial statements mean? Do you understand how and why your accounts are charged for various expenses? These questions and more will be answered as the various accounting tools available within the USC system are explained in this workshop. An informative and interactive format will be used to teach you how to: read and understand the Monthly Management Reports and the General Ledger Monthly Summary, gain up-to-date information about expenses, revenue, and account balances, prepare or request journal entries and Intra-Institutional Transfers (IDTs), use the University class codes appropriately, and monitor your accounts on a daily basis rather than waiting for month-end reports. This workship combines classroom instruction with individual computer access and practice.
